Meat and meat products are highly nourishing food consumed by people all over the world. It is a highly perishable nutritious, protein-rich food and leads to its deterioration from the time of slaughter until consumption owing to its biological and chemical nature. Generally, the internal tissues of healthy slaughtered animals are free of bacteria at the time of slaughter. Meat and meat products get contaminated through various sources including the animal itself, equipment, environment and during storage. Further, the unhygienic conditions during slaughter, retail shops and handling of meat may add to the contamination. Buffaloes are considered as heavy meat-producing animals. The buffalo meat production has been increasing over the years. Fresh buffalo meat may harbour spoilage as well as pathogenic microflora depending on pH, composition, textures, storage temperature and transportation means. The contaminated meat and meat products from buffalo are important sources of zoonotic infections caused by a variety of bacteria, viruses, yeasts and moulds and parasites. The common spoilage bacteria isolated from fresh buffalo meat include bacteria of the genera Acinetobacter, Pseudomonas, Brochothrix thermosphacta, Flavobacterium, Psychrobacter and Moraxella; staphylococci; micrococci; lactic acid bacteria (LAB); and various genera of the Enterobacteriaceae. The microbial pathogens found in fresh buffalo meat are Escherichia coli, Staphylococcus aureus, Listeria monocytogenes, Salmonella, Aeromonas spp., Clostridium difficile, Arcobacter spp., Bacillus cereus, Campylobacter spp., Sarcocystis spp. and Toxoplasma gondii.
